Dave Fanning presents The Cranberries with a platinum disc on 'The Late Late Show'.

The Limerick band were on the programme to promote their second album, 'No Need to Argue', having achieved international success with their first album 'Everybody Else is Doing It, So Why Can't We?' (1993).

The Cranberries sold almost 3 million copies of their first album worldwide, but this platinum disc is specifically for Irish sales. They sold 45 to 55 thousand copies in the country, which makes it double platinum album.

The band have sold more debut albums than anybody else in terms of Irish bands.

They were presented with a platinum disc by 2FM's Dave Fanning.

This episode of The Late Late Show was broadcast 23 September 1994. The presenter is Gay Byrne.
